Q:   Is NEET mandatory for BSc Nursing admission in India?
A: 

While NEET UG is widely accepted and required for government colleges and most deemed universities, many private nursing colleges also offer admission based on their own institutional entrance exams or merit in Class 12. Many colleges accept students on merit basis and through entrance exams other than NEET. Students who could not score well in NEET can still find good private colleges through institutional exams like MET, SRMJEEH, and state-level nursing council exams.

Q:   What entrance exams are accepted for BSc Nursing admission in India?
A: 

NEET UG is widely accepted for govt. and deemed universities. MET for Manipal and exams by CMC Vellore, Amrita, SRMJEEH are conducted by institutions. Nursing councils of individual states conduct state level exams. Many colleges conduct merit admission based on Class 12 marks. Hence, even with a low NEET score students can secure admission through various other opportunities.

Q:   What is post basic nursing?
A: 

PB BSc or Post Basic BSc Nursing is a 2 year undergraduate nursing course specialisation for registered nurses with an ANM certificate or GNM diploma. 

It is a good degree for students who want to move from basics to more advanced education if they want to pursue roles in leadership or teaching.

Q:   Which specialisation is better OBGYN or Neonatal?
A: 

Comparing two nursing courses and deciding the better course is subjective to each student. If we talk about comparing Obstetrics & Gynaecology Nursing and Neonatal, Infant & Newborn Nursing, it depends entirely if the student wants to care for the mother or the child. The OBGYN specialisation focuses on women's reproductive health, labour, pregnancy and postpartum care. The neonatal specialisation is more about newborns. It aims at childcare, premature birth, illness or defects after birth.

Q:   I am 32 years old. Can I still pursue BSc Nursing?
A: 

Yes,  you can. According to the Indian Nursing Council, the minimum age of an applicant must be 17 years,  whereas the maximum limit is 35 years. You will need verified documents like 12th marksheet, Aadhar Card, etc.

Q:   Which Medical fields offer the best work-life balance?
A: 

Some medical field which offer best work and life balance are shown below -

  • Dentistry (BDS & MDS) – Fixed clinic hours, fewer emergencies.

  • Pharmacy (BPharm & MPharm) – Less stress compared to hospital-based jobs.

  • Physiotherapy (BPT & MPT) – Flexible working hours, minimal emergency calls.

  • Public Health & Community Medicine – Focus on preventive healthcare rather than emergency treatments.

  • Clinical Research & Medical Writing – Research-based work with no direct patient responsibilities.
